Adjusting Entries
Journal entries used to adjust account balances in order to reflect more accurate financial information at the end of an accounting period.
Journal Entry
A record in accounting that notes a specific financial transaction in the books.
Debit Amount
A financial entry that increases an asset or expense account, or decreases a liability, equity, or revenue account.
Credit
A financial term that refers to the provision of resources (such as funds) by one party to another, where the second party does not repay the first party immediately but incurs a debt and is usually obliged to pay interest.
